South African flag High Commission of South Africa in Maseru

AddressStandard Lesotho Bank Tower
10th Floor, Kingsway
Maseru 0100
Lesotho
Phonelocal: 2231.5758
international: +266.2231.5758
Faxlocal: 2232.5228
international: +266.2232.5228
Emailmaseru.admin@foreign.gov.za
